Muirend Station ensures that passengers have a seamless experience when buying or collecting their train tickets. The ticket office opens Monday to Saturday from 06:55 to 13:59 and is complemented by ticket machines which are accessible to all. Those who purchase tickets online can collect them from the accessible ticket machines located within the station.
While the station may not boast extravagant amenities, it offers crucial features for travelers. Staff are available to provide help and support, particularly on weekdays, and customer information screens give real-time updates. Though there are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, the station provides a seating area where travelers can wait in comfort.
Muirend prides itself on being accessible, labeled as a Category A station which indicates step-free access to both platforms. However, travelers should be cautious of the stepping distance between the train and platform. While there is no staff help outside of the stated hours, passenger assistance is readily available with prior booking. Bicycle enthusiasts will be pleased to find sheltered bicycle stands and hire facilities through CycleLane, ensuring a smooth transition from pedal power to rail propulsion.
Muirend is well-linked with other modes of transport, simplifying onward travel. Rail replacement buses operate from Muirend Road on the bridge outside the station, and taxi services can be arranged via online resources like TrainTaxi. For those preferring road travel, local bus services cover a broad area detailed on Traveline Scotland or by calling 0871 200 22 33.

Morpeth Train Station is equipped to meet the needs of any traveler. Open from Monday to Friday between 06:30 and 17:30, and Saturdays until 13:00, the ticket office provides ample opportunity for purchasing tickets. For convenience, ticket machines are available and include features to aid accessibility. The station supports smartcard issuance and allows for online ticket collection, although it’s worth noting that there aren’t any smartcard validators at the site.
Travelers requiring assistance can benefit from a variety of services. Staff assistance is available during ticket office hours or via a helpline outside these times. The station features step-free access, ensuring easy navigation for all passengers, and additional amenities such as an induction loop and ramp access to trains cater to enhanced mobility needs. Unfortunately, facilities such as waiting rooms and refreshment conveniences are lacking, with no accessible toilets or lounge areas.
When it comes to onward travel, Morpeth Train Station does not disappoint. With a taxi rank located next to the booking office, getting to your next destination is straightforward. Should you prefer public transport, there’s a bus service with a convenient turning point by platform 1. Rail replacement services are also accessible from the station front, providing additional peace of mind should you need it. While cycle hire is not available directly at the station, those who bring their bicycles can use the secure cycle facilities provided.
